Dutch football team coach Louis van Gaal announced the list of players who will travel to the World Cup in Qatar. Liverpool player Virgil van Dijk and Barcelona player Memphis Depay are expected to go to Qatar, among others.
The 26-player list does not include Bayern midfielder Ryan Gravenberch, while 19-year-old PSV player Xavi Simons is included in the squad.
Experienced Jesper Cillessen will not be in goal, who will thus miss the second major competition after the European Championship.
The Netherlands will play in Group A with Qatar, Ecuador and Senegal at the World Cup. They will play their first match on November 21 against Senegal.
Netherlands squad:
Goalkeeper: Justin Bijlow (Feyenoord), Remko Pasveer (Ajax), Andries Noppert (Heerenveen).
Defense: Nathan Ake (Manchester City), Virgil van Dijk (Liverpool), Mathijs de Light (Bayern), Jurrien Timber (Ajax), Stefan de Vrij (Inter), Daley Blind (Ajax), Denzel Dumfries (Inter), Tyrell Malacia (Manchester United), Jeremie Frimpong (Bayer Leverkusen).
Midfield: Steven Berghuis (Ajax), Frenkie de Jong (Barcelona), Cody Gakpo (PSV), Teun Koopmeiners (Atalanta), Marten de Roon (Atalanta), Xavi Simmons (PSV), Kenneth Taylor (Ajax), Davy Klaassen (Ajax).
Attack: Steven Bergwijn (Ajax), Memphis Depay (Barcelona), Vincent Janssen (Antwerp), Luuk de Jong (PSV), Wout Weghorst (Besiktas), Noa Lang (Club Bruges).
